We're evaluating the Agile support for YouTrack in the EAP version. The one feature or options we'd like to see on the swim lane support is to have the swim lanes display attributes of the tickets rather than the tickets OR the ability to create arbitrary swim lanes that are not tickets in the system. For example, there is an option to show the swim lanes based on the priority so all ticket of a particular priority become swim lanes. It would be more useful to have the swim lanes defined for the priorities, not ticket of that priority. So in the case of priorities, instead of all the tickets of "Normal" priority becoming swim lanes, each Priority value would be a swim lane so you'd see 5 lanes (in the hosted trial) Minor, Nomal, Major, Critical, Show-Stopper. The tickets would then fall into these lanes as they are added to the sprint based on their priority.
